2010-11-19 83 views
-2

我想處理觸摸UIWebView相同,因爲我們可以處理觸摸UIView.I想要使用觸摸開始,觸摸結束等在這個應用程序的方法。我必須處理在UIWebView上的不同觸摸事件的多個事件。如何控制對UIWebView的觸摸? (iphone)

在這個應用程序中,我在UIWeb視圖中顯示圖像,並且我必須在雙擊時將圖像大小變大,當用戶點擊該圖像時,下一個圖像應該出現,並且如果用戶雙擊該圖像應該導航到另一個頁面,如果用戶滑動,那麼也應該出現下一個圖像。因此,我必須處理觸摸UIWebView的四個事件。

請任何人告訴我如何做到這一點。我已經嘗試了很多代碼,但沒有任何幫助我。我也嘗試通過在uiwebview上進行uiview,但只有一個事件發生的其他事件不會。

在此先感謝。

回答

1

對於你想要做的事情聽起來好像你不應該使用uiwebview。我建議你重新考慮你的應用程序的體系結構:通常在視圖控制器中處理觸摸事件和頁面導航(你正在嘗試的兩種)。考慮實現一個處理這些事件的視圖控制器。

此外,請勿索取代碼並要求通過電子郵件交付代碼。沒有人想寫你的代碼,而且你也不會學習任何方式。

+0

kevboh,我們不能通過在不使用UIWebView的情況下點擊它來增加或減少圖像大小,因此我已經使用UIWebView.Thanks來獲得關於發送代碼的建議。我給出了電子郵件,以便如果有人有代碼,然後發送給我不寫新代碼。 – vicky 2010-11-19 16:56:18

+0

您可以使用uiimageview輕鬆縮放圖像。 cocoawithlove(http://cocoawithlove.com/2010/09/zoomingviewcontroller-to-animate-uiview.html)只是一個很好的例子,只需通過uiview進行縮放。前臺加載你的工作並投入一些時間來研究uiviews是非常好的,這樣你就不必嘗試圍繞uiwebview的觸摸處理進行編碼了,我保證最終的工作會更多。 – kevboh 2010-11-19 17:00:11

+0

謝謝親愛的,我認爲這篇文章肯定會幫助我。 – vicky 2010-11-19 18:12:02